ADI Global Distribution, is currently looking for an Associate Demand Planner to join their growing Demand Planning team. In this position, you will be responsible for both demand management and inventory planning of specific product lines for the North American market. You will work collaboratively along multiple departments that have a direct impact on the business. Partnering with Product Management, Sales, Customers, Suppliers, Transportation, and Distribution will be a key part of your daily role.

JOB DUTIES:
 

  • Lead weekly buy and inventory management for assigned categories, ensuring alignment to service and inventory targets
  • Own Open-to-Buy (OTB) planning and supplier investment strategies to balance availability and working capital
  •  Drive consensus demand planning by partnering with Product Management, Sales, Finance, and Supply Planning
  • Proactively manage supply constraints and risk mitigation, collaborating closely with suppliers and internal stakeholders
  • Analyze in-stock, fill rate, and forecast accuracy performance, leading initiatives to close gaps and improve KPIs
  • Partner on and influence promotional and lifecycle planning, ensuring readiness for demand shifts and new product introductions
  • Lead excess and obsolete inventory reduction strategies through data-driven insights and cross-functional action plans
  • Identify and implement process improvements, automation opportunities, and best practices within demand planning workflows
  • Act as a subject matter expert and mentor to junior planners, providing guidance and support as needed
  • Participate in and/or lead cross-functional projects and strategic initiatives that drive business impact
